The cost of conveyor systems varies depending on complexity, automation level, and customization requirements.
| Conveyor Type | Price Range (USD) | Application |
|---|---|---|
| Basic Belt Conveyor | $5,000 - $20,000 | Material handling |
| Modular Conveyor System | $15,000 - $60,000 | Packaging lines |
| Automated Conveyor System | $50,000 - $200,000+ | High-speed production |
| Cleanroom Conveyor | $30,000 - $150,000 | Sterile environments |
